TUITION AND REFUND POLICY

 

  • Application fee is non-refundable regardless of Admissions Decisions.
  • The re-enrollment/enrollment fee (KRW 3,000,000) is a part of annual tuition which needs to be deposited at the time of re-enrollment or within two weeks of acceptance for the new enrollment and the full amount would be NON-REFUNDABLE after one week from the re-enrollment/enrollment due date. It would be refundable only in a situation which is totally out of student’s control and can be proved by the document before the new school year starts in August. Fully paid annual tuition fees can be refunded in the case of early withdrawal; 65% of annual tuition fees during the 1st term, 35% during the 2nd term. There is no refund during the 3rd term. Please check the school calendar for the start and the end of each term for the respective school year.
  • Tuition and fees are due and payable upon acceptance of the student by the school.
  • Tuition and fees should be wire transferred to the Chadwick International’s designated bank accounts within 10 working days after acceptance. The school’s banking information is posted on the school’s web site.
  • Students who enter the school after the school year begins or withdraw during the school year will have a discount or refund on the tuition according to schedule below.
  • A late fee will be assessed interest at the rate of 1.5% per month on any outstanding balance after the due date.
  • Refunds will be made to parent account directly or to their authorized representative.
  • In the event of FORCE MAJEURE(when the school decides to shut down its operation before the end of the regular school year due to civil unrest, labor strike, war or other natural or man-made disasters beyond the school’s control), which causes students to withdraw from the school, tuition and fees already paid for the school year, will not be refunded.
